CHEESE AND ONION ENCHILADAS



Cheese and Onion Enchiladas image

This is a simple, rewarding recipe for a batch of Cheese and Onion Enchiladas. I used Ancho and Guajillo chiles for this batch and they were delicious!

Number Of Ingredients 16

4 Ancho dried chiles
2 Guajillo dried chiles
1 small onion
3 garlic cloves
3 cups stock
2 plum tomatoes
1/2 lb. melting cheese (I used Jack)
1/2 onion, finely chopped (for the filling)
8-10 corn tortillas
1/2 teaspoon cumin
1 teaspoon Mexican oregano
1/2 teaspoon salt (plus more to taste)
freshly ground black pepper
olive oil
Queso Fresco (optional)
freshly chopped cilantro (optional)

Steps:

  • Start by rinsing and de-stemming the tomatoes. Roast them in the oven (400F) for 20 minutes or until you need them.
  • Wipe off any dusty crevasses on the dried chiles, then de-stem and de-seed them. Roast the chile pieces in the oven at 400F for 1-2 minutes. Once roasted you can add the chile pieces to a bowl, cover with hot tap water, and let them reconstitute for 20-30 minutes.
  • Roughly chop an onion. Saute the onion in a glug of oil over medium heat along with 3 whole, peeled garlic cloves. Cook until the onion is starting to brown.
  • Note: before draining the dried chiles you can take a taste of their soaking liquid. If you like the flavor you are welcome to use it in place of stock for the sauce. If, like me, you think it tastes bitter then it's best to use stock for your enchilada sauces.
  • Drain the dried chiles. Add the drained chiles, the roasted tomatoes, the onion-garlic mixture, and 3 cups of stock to a blender. Blend until smooth. You can optionally strain the blender sauce through a fine mesh sieve and discard the leftover seeds and skin, but lately I skip this step.
  • Cook the enchilada sauce for a few minutes over medium heat in the same pan that cooked the onion-garlic mixture. Add 1/2 teaspoon cumin, 1 teaspoon Mexican oregano, 1/2 teaspoon of salt, and some freshly cracked black pepper. Let simmer for a few minutes and then take a final taste for seasoning.
  • Warm up the corn tortillas in the oven for 1-2 minutes, or cover them with a damp paper towel and nuke them in the microwave for 60 seconds.
  • Shred 1/2 lb. of melting cheese (I used Jack) and finely chop 1/2 an onion for the insides of the enchiladas.
  • To build the enchiladas, start by adding a few tablespoons of the sauce to a plate. Dredge a tortilla in the sauce and flip it over. Fill with plenty of cheese and finely chopped onion. Roll tight and set them seam side down in a baking dish. You can add some sauce to the baking dish to prevent sticking. You'll get about 8-10 enchiladas from this recipe, depending on how much filling you use in each tortilla -- I loaded these up and got 8 enchiladas from this batch.
  • Cover the rolled enchiladas with sauce and bake for 8-10 minutes (400F) or until the cheese is melted. Top with your choice of fixings (I used Queso Fresco and freshly chopped cilantro) and serve immediately.

CHEESE & ONION ENCHILADAS



Cheese & Onion Enchiladas image

Handed down from my first mother-in-law from Oklahoma in 1960. it is prepared kinda backward but tastes great to me. I make around 20 at a time,eat some and freeze the rest in portions.

Time 40m

Yield 20 enchiladas, 10 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 6

corn tortilla
28 ounces las palmas enchilada sauce
8 ounces tomato sauce
vegetable oil, as needed
grated cheddar cheese
chopped onion

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 350f.
  • heat sauces together in 6" minimum diameter saucepan.
  • heat a tablespoon of oil in a 6" minimum diameter frying pan.
  • With tongs, immerse a tortilla in the sauce then put it in the frying pan for a few seconds, flip it over for a few seconds then lay it in a baking sheet.
  • Repeat, putting a little oil into the pan for each tortilla until you have a stack of tortillas.
  • Put desired amount of cheese, then onions on the tortilla, fold it and lay it seam down.When you have enough of them, spoon some sauce over them and sprinkle with cheese to your liking.Shove the pan in the oven for 10 min.to melt the cheese. To serve,put a serving of enchiladas on a plate with some cheese- sprinkled runny refried beans and heat 5 minute in oven.

CHEESE AND ONION ENCHILADAS



Cheese and Onion Enchiladas image

When I eat at a Mexican restaurant, I always like to order cheese and onion enchiladas as opposed to the ones with meat in them. I am glad I found this recipe. Whip this recipe up with ingredients you have on hand.

Time 55m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 9

2 tablespoons oil
2 onions, chopped
1/2 teaspoon dried oregano
1/4 teaspoon salt
1 (15 1/2 ounce) can beans, such as kidney, rinsed and drained (optional)
2 cups shredded cheddar cheese (or monterey and colby)
1 (8 ounce) can tomato sauce
3/4 teaspoon chili powder
8 corn tortillas or 8 flour tortillas

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ees.
  • Grease 1 1/2 quart baking dish.
  • In skillet, heat oil over medium-high heat. Add onions, oregano and salt. Cook, stirring occasionally, until softened.
  • Remove from heat, stir in beans, if using, and 1 1/2 cups cheese. Combine sauce, 2 T water and chili powder.
  • Dip each tortilla into sauce; place on plate.
  • Spoon 1/3 cup cheese-onion mixture down center of tortilla. Roll up, place seam-side down in baking dish. Repeat.
  • Top with remaining sauce and cheese.
  • Bake until hot 20-25 minutes.

ONION & 3-CHEESE ENCHILADAS



Onion & 3-Cheese Enchiladas image

This recipe appeared 06/09/06 on the ABC News site. It is from the former chef at the White House who had served the Clintons for eight years and the Bushes for four. He said it was a favorite of both families. It is delicious!

Time 50m

Yield 8 enchiladas, 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 22

8 ounces jalapeno jack cheese, grated
8 ounces cheddar cheese, grated
2 ounces queso fresco
1 tablespoon olive oil
2 cups sweet onions, large diced
2 teaspoons ground coriander
1 tablespoon ground cumin
hot sauce, to taste
salt and pepper, to taste
8 corn tortillas
1 tablespoon olive oil
1 cup onion, diced
1 tablespoon jalapeno, fine diced
1 tablespoon minced garlic
1/2 tablespoon chipotle chile in adobo
1 cup roasted tomatoes, chopped
1 1/2 cups stock or 1 1/2 cups water
2 teaspoons cumin
1 teaspoon coriander
1 teaspoon oregano
1/2 teaspoon cinnamon
salt and pepper, to taste

Steps:

  • Filling:.
  • In a saute pan over medium heat, saute diced onion in oil until tender and slightly colored -- 4-6 minutes.
  • Season with coriander, cumin, hot sauce and S&P.
  • Let onion mix cool to room temperature, and hold to fill enchiladas.
  • Combine all the cheese except 2 oz each of the jack and cheddar with the onion mixture, fold together well.
  • Slightly warm the tortillas in a warm saute pan to make them flexible, and put about 2/3 cup of the cheese mix on each tortilla and roll them up.
  • Place the rolled tortillas in a lightly oiled casserole dish in a single layer.
  • Sauce:.
  • In a 2 quart sauce pot over medium heat, cook onions in oil until tender -- 3-5 minutes.
  • Add diced jalapeno and garlic and cook 2 minutes more.
  • Add tomatotes, stock and all seasonings; let simmer 15 minutes.
  • Puree and strain the sauce and hold for service.
  • To assemble the dish:.
  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ees.
  • Ladle sauce over the enchiladas in the casserole dish, top with the remaining cheese.
  • Bake covered for 15-20 minutes, until hot thoughout and cheese is well-melted.
  • Serve hot.
